Gil Hodges was a Hall of Fame first baseman who was born on April 4, 1924 in Princeton, IN. He was a key part of the Brooklyn and Los Angeles Dodgers teams that won World Series Championships in 1955 and 1959. After his retirement, he became a manager and led the Miracle Mets to a World Series Championship in 1969.

Before Fame

He served in World War II as an anti-aircraft gunner with the Marine Corps and was awarded a Bronze Star for his Service.

Trivia

He was named to 8 All-Star games over the course of his career.

Family Life

He married Joan Lombardi in 1948, and they remained together until his death.

Associated With

He was teammates with Roy Campanella on the Dodgers from 1948 to 1957.
